POCO F7 Series Receives HyperOS 3 Update with Enhanced Performance and New AI Features

POCO has officially rolled out the global update for HyperOS 3 to its F7 and F7 Pro models. This new system software aims to boost device performance and introduce advanced artificial intelligence (AI) features to enhance user experience.

The update is distributed gradually to minimize disruptions across regions. It also strengthens connectivity within Xiaomi’s ecosystem, ensuring smoother interaction between different devices.

Global Rollout Details

The HyperOS 3 update began deployment in late November 2025 via the stable tester channel. POCO F7 Pro received the build numbered HyperOS 3.0.4.0.WOKMIXM, while the POCO F7 got HyperOS 3.0.3.0.WOLMIXM. Xiaomi employs this phased rollout strategy to maintain system stability and reduce performance issues during installation.

This method was previously used during the launch of HyperOS on flagship models like the Xiaomi 14 and Redmi K70 series. Users are advised to check for updates under Settings > About Phone > HyperOS Version > Check for Updates, keeping in mind that availability may vary regionally.

Performance and Efficiency Enhancements

HyperOS 3 primarily focuses on optimizing how system resources are allocated. It intelligently learns user app usage patterns, enabling faster app loading times. Improvements span CPU management, RAM utilization, and background process handling.

As a result, the devices offer increased responsiveness, particularly noticeable during heavy multitasking or prolonged gaming sessions. The update also refines the user interface with smoother animations and uniform visual elements, creating lighter transitions even on devices with varying RAM capacities.

Advanced AI Features Integration

This update brings deeper AI integration previously seen in Xiaomi’s premium models. HyperOS 3 enhances real-time AI-powered subtitle generation and text recognition accuracy, improving accessibility and user convenience.

A notable addition is AI-assisted editing within native apps, which can analyze context to provide automatic suggestions for system navigation, search, and device settings adjustments. Xiaomi plans to release additional AI capabilities through minor updates, aligning with features introduced on flagship devices such as the Xiaomi 14 Ultra and MIX Fold 4.

Strengthened Ecosystem Connectivity with HyperConnect

HyperOS 3 enhances the HyperConnect feature, further improving cross-device connectivity. Users of POCO F7 Series can expect faster file transfers between devices and real-time clipboard synchronization, making multitasking across gadgets more seamless.

IoT device control also benefits from a streamlined architecture, boosting response speed and expanding integration options beyond what was available under previous MIUI versions.
